A essential challenge in overhead line design is controlling the changeover in between distinct segments of the conductor. This is where the Parallel Groove Clamp gets indispensable. These equipment are primarily utilized to connect two parallel conductors, normally of a similar or different materials, for instance aluminum or copper. By using a superior-energy bolting system, the Parallel Groove Clamp guarantees a organization mechanical grip as well as a small-resistance electrical route. They're intended with specific grooves that match the diameter of the cables, preventing slippage and shielding the strands from the conductor from staying crushed or deformed under pressure. This equilibrium of business grip and material protection is vital for stopping hotspots that can cause line failure.

On the subject of the structural support of aerial cables, The strain Clamp serves as the primary anchor. These clamps are designed to go ahead and take mechanical load of your cable, making sure it continues to be at the right sag and stress among utility poles. Dependant upon the natural environment and the kind of cable getting deployed, distinct materials are utilized for these elements. For instance, Aluminum Alloy Rigidity Clamps are commonly favored in higher-voltage and medium-voltage purposes because of their Remarkable toughness-to-pounds ratio and pure resistance to atmospheric corrosion. For the reason that aluminum won't rust like iron-based mostly metals, Aluminum Alloy Tension Clamps offer a long-Long lasting Answer in coastal or industrial spots wherever the air may very well be laden with salt or pollutants.

As telecommunications and reduced-voltage electrical distribution have expanded, the field has witnessed an increase in using the Plastic Stress Clamp. Whilst steel clamps are needed for heavy transmission lines, the Plastic Pressure Clamp gives a lightweight, non-conductive, and price-powerful substitute for lesser diameter cables, for example fiber optic traces or small-voltage fall wires. These are often made from substantial-density, UV-stabilized polymers that may stand up to many years of publicity to direct sunlight and Extraordinary temperatures with no getting to be brittle. The usage of plastic gets rid of the risk of galvanic corrosion involving the clamp along with the cable sheath, rendering it an ideal choice for precise contemporary utility rollouts.

For the particular distribution of electricity from the most crucial line to particular person structures, the tactic of tapping into the Dwell wire is revolutionized by LV Piercing Cable Connectors. In past times, personnel had to strip away a bit with the cable’s insulation to produce a connection, a process which was time-consuming and greater the potential risk of moisture ingress and subsequent corrosion. The development of your Insulation Piercing Connector adjusted this paradigm fully. An Insulation Piercing Connector options specialised metallic enamel that, when tightened, Chunk in the outer insulation layer to generate contact with the internal conductor. This creates a hermetically sealed connection that is certainly both electrically sound and shielded from The weather.

The use of LV Piercing Cable Connectors considerably boosts employee safety because it allows for "Are living-line" installations. Because the insulation won't should be taken out manually, there is a A great deal decrease chance of accidental contact with a live conductor. Moreover, as the Insulation Piercing Connector seals the puncture level as it truly is installed, it helps prevent the "wicking" outcome where water travels up The within of a cable’s insulation, that's a number one reason for long-time period cable degradation. These connectors at the moment are the global regular for reduced-voltage aerial bundled cable techniques, giving a bridge between the leading utility feed and the tip-user’s provider entrance.

At the extremely conclusion of your electrical path, the place the cable meets a transformer, a circuit breaker, or perhaps a busbar, Cable Lugs are utilized to finalize the link. Cable Lugs are in essence the interface concerning the versatile cable and the rigid terminal. They are typically produced from large-conductivity copper or aluminum and therefore are crimped or bolted onto the end of the conductor. A high-high-quality set of Cable Lugs ensures that the transition of present-day continues to be economical, reducing voltage drops and heat technology within the termination place. Without effectively rated Cable Lugs, even probably the most strong overhead process would deal with failures in the factors of delivery.
